- a. Tripped Circuit Breaker: A tripped circuit breaker is often the first thing to check. Overloads, short circuits, or ground faults can cause the breaker to trip, cutting off power to the compressor. Resetting the breaker might solve the problem, but it’s essential to identify the underlying cause to prevent recurrence. If the breaker trips repeatedly, it indicates a more serious issue that requires professional attention.
- b. Blown Fuse: Similar to a circuit breaker, a blown fuse indicates an overcurrent situation. Fuses are designed to protect the compressor and other components from damage. Replacing the fuse might temporarily restore functionality, but the root cause of the overcurrent must be addressed.
- c. Low Voltage: Compressors require a specific voltage range to operate correctly. Low voltage can occur due to problems with the power grid, undersized wiring, or excessive voltage drop in the circuit. Using a multimeter to check the voltage at the compressor terminals is crucial. If the voltage is below the specified range, investigate the power supply and wiring.
- d. Loose Wiring Connections: Loose or corroded wiring connections can impede the flow of electricity to the compressor. Inspect all wiring connections at the compressor, contactor, and other relevant components. Tighten any loose connections and clean corroded terminals.

- a. Start Capacitor: The start capacitor provides the extra boost needed to start the compressor motor. A faulty start capacitor is a common cause of start problems. Capacitors can fail due to age, overheating, or voltage surges. Testing the capacitor with a multimeter is necessary to determine its condition. A bulging or leaking capacitor is a clear indication of failure.
- b. Run Capacitor: While the start capacitor aids in initial startup, the run capacitor helps maintain efficient motor operation. A failing run capacitor can cause the compressor to struggle to start or run inefficiently. Testing the run capacitor is similar to testing the start capacitor.
- c. Potential Relay: The potential relay is responsible for disconnecting the start capacitor once the compressor motor reaches a certain speed. A faulty potential relay can prevent the start capacitor from disengaging, leading to overheating and potential motor damage. Testing the potential relay involves checking its continuity and voltage.

- a. Burned or Corroded Contacts: The contactor is an electrical switch that controls the flow of power to the compressor motor. Over time, the contacts can become burned or corroded, leading to poor electrical contact and preventing the compressor from starting. Inspect the contactor for signs of damage and replace it if necessary.
- b. Weak or Damaged Coil: The contactor coil energizes the switch, allowing power to flow to the compressor. A weak or damaged coil can prevent the contactor from closing properly. Testing the coil with a multimeter can determine its condition.

- a. Open Windings: The compressor motor windings can become open due to overheating, insulation breakdown, or physical damage. An open winding will prevent the motor from starting. Testing the windings with a multimeter will reveal any open circuits.
- b. Shorted Windings: Shorted windings occur when the insulation between the motor windings breaks down, causing a short circuit. Shorted windings can draw excessive current and trip the circuit breaker. Testing the windings with a multimeter can identify shorted circuits.
- c. Grounded Windings: Grounded windings occur when the motor windings come into contact with the metal casing of the compressor. This can create a dangerous electrical shock hazard. Testing for grounded windings involves using a multimeter to check for continuity between the windings and the compressor casing.

- a. Bearing Failure: Bearing failure can cause the compressor rotor to seize, preventing it from turning. This is often accompanied by unusual noises.
- b. Piston or Valve Damage: Damage to the pistons or valves within the compressor can also cause the rotor to lock up.
- c. Liquid Floodback: Liquid refrigerant entering the compressor can cause hydraulic lock, preventing the rotor from turning.

- a. Lack of Lubrication: Insufficient lubrication can lead to increased friction and wear, eventually causing the compressor to seize.
- b. Oil Sludging: Over time, the compressor oil can degrade and form sludge, which can clog oil passages and prevent proper lubrication.
- c. Contaminated Oil: Contaminants in the oil, such as moisture or acid, can damage internal components and lead to compressor failure.

- a. Valve Plate Damage: The valve plate controls the flow of refrigerant into and out of the compressor cylinders. Damage to the valve plate can affect compression efficiency and potentially prevent the compressor from starting.
- b. Piston Ring Damage: Damaged piston rings can reduce compression and lead to oil blow-by, which can further damage the compressor.

- a. Leaks: Refrigerant leaks can cause the system to lose its charge, reducing cooling capacity and potentially preventing the compressor from starting. A low refrigerant charge can also cause the compressor to overheat.
- b. Improper Charging: Incorrect refrigerant charging can also lead to low refrigerant levels.

- a. Clogged Condenser Coil: A clogged condenser coil can restrict airflow, causing the refrigerant pressure to increase. This can make it difficult for the compressor to start.
- b. Overcharged System: An overcharged system can also lead to high head pressure.
- c. Non-Condensables in the System: The presence of non-condensable gases, such as air, in the refrigerant system can also increase head pressure.

- 1. Voltage Test: Verify that the correct voltage is present at the compressor terminals.
- 2. Continuity Test: Check the continuity of the motor windings, start and run capacitors, potential relay, and contactor coil.
- 3. Resistance Test: Measure the resistance of the motor windings to check for open or shorted circuits.
- 4. Capacitor Test: Use a capacitance meter to test the capacitance of the start and run capacitors.

- 1. Compressor Rotation Test: Attempt to manually rotate the compressor shaft. If the shaft is locked, it indicates a mechanical problem.
- 2. Oil Level Check: Check the oil level in the compressor (if applicable).
- 3. Refrigerant Pressure Test: Use gauges to measure the refrigerant pressure in the system.

- 1. Amp Clamp: An amp clamp can be used to measure the current draw of the compressor motor. High current draw can indicate a locked rotor or other motor problem.
- 2. Infrared Thermometer: An infrared thermometer can be used to check for overheating components.
